Sometimes it seems that no matter how much energy we put into navigating life's complexities a stable experience of contentment eludes us. Painful states of mind, such as anxiety, dissatisfaction, and anger continue to sabotage all our hard work.
We can use the philosophy of Buddhism to help us understand why this happens and learn reliable methods to shift our efforts into creating a stable happiness, regardless of our external conditions.
What to expect:
- Classes are approximately 1-1/4 hours long.
- Classes include two guided meditations and a talk on Buddhism for everyday living.
- Occasionally Q&A is offered at the end of the class.
- Although part of a series, each class is self-contained so you can check out any single class or jump into the series midstream.
